Iron deficiency protects inbred mice against infection with Plasmodium chabaudi.
Authors:P W Harvey   R G Bell     M C Nesheim
Abstract:Plasmodium chabaudi infections of NFR/N mice made anemic by dietary iron deficiency produced mortalities of 25% (male) and 7% (female) compared with 100% in iron-sufficient controls. When iron-deficient mice convalescing from the primary infection were returned to the normal diet, 100% experienced recrudescent parasitemia. No recrudescence occurred in mice maintained on the iron-deficient diet.
